Hello everyone,
While I was reproducing the result of the first example for the memory functions, a runtime error arose. Please find the source code 'Memory_func_ex1', and the corresponding given document by
Usage Examples for the Memory Functions (intel.com)
After I changing declaration part of the arrays A, B, and C, the code ran without errors. Please find the attached source code 'Memory_func_ex1_rev' of the revised version.
So, I am wondering if this is really a bug in the given code, or I made something wrong.
The only things I changed from the given code are
- I do not use
INCLUDE 'mkl.fi'
- I chose the following for my 64bit system
INTEGER*8 MKL_MALLOC, MKL_CALLOC, MKL_REALLOC
INTEGER*8 ALLOC_SIZE, NUM, SIZE
Thank you very much.

What Runtime error are You talking about? Could you clarify? I see no runtime problem with this code example. Running this code main.f90 with Memory_func_ex1.f90 call only, I see no problem.
Here are the logs :
$ ./a.out
DGEMM uses 232271624 bytes in 47 buffers
Peak memory allocated by Intel MKL memory allocator 0
bytes. Start to count new memory peak
After reset of peak memory counter
Peak memory allocated by Intel MKL memory allocator 0
bytes
Here, I switch on the verbose mode to show MKL version details:
$ export MKL_VERBOSE=1
$ ./a.out
MKL_VERBOSE oneMKL 2021.0 Update 3 Product build 20210617 for Intel(R) 64 architecture Intel(R) Advanced Vector Extensions 2 (Intel(R) AVX2) enabled processors, Lnx 2.20GHz lp64 intel_thread
MKL_VERBOSE DGEMM(N,N,1000,1000,1000,0x7fffd4002df0,0x2b6b92c58080,1000,0x2b6b933fa080,1000,0x7fffd4002df8,0x2b6b93b9c080,1000) 59.31ms CNR:OFF Dyn:1 FastMM:1 TID:0 NThr:44
DGEMM uses 232271624 bytes in 47 buffers
Peak memory allocated by Intel MKL memory allocator 0
bytes. Start to count new memory peak
After reset of peak memory counter
Peak memory allocated by Intel MKL memory allocator 0
bytes
